#601508 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#601508 is composed of 37.6% red, 8.2%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 78.1% magenta, 91.7% yellow and 62.4% black. It has a hue angle of 8.9 degrees, a saturation of 84.6% and a lightness of 20.4%. #601508 color hex could be obtained by blending #c02a10 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660000.

#601508 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#601508 has RGB values of R:96, G:21, B:8 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.78, Y:0.92,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 6296840.
